    I have a Hoover TV 30 dryer that is no longer heating. I have removed the back element cover and after a general inspection (black marks on the element coils) I assume that it needs to be replaced. Can anyone advise me on a) how to test the element to verify that it has actually gone and b) where is the best place to buy a new element.

    A continuity check is the only sure way power off of course :zap:

    But it’s a common enough failure to be 90{e5d1b7155a01ef1f3b9c9968eaba33524ee81600d00d4be2b4d93ac2e58cec2d} certain that’s the fault.

    It’s always the heater with these……… With the power off, you should not get a circuit reading through the heater when tested with a multimeter.
